Wolff explains Allison's increased involvement across Mercedes motorsport

Article To news overview Toto Wolff has explained that James Allison's role within Mercedes will have a wider perspective than just Formula 1, when the engineer leaves his role as Technical Director. Allison and Mercedes confirmed, prior to Imola, that he will be stepping aside from the Technical Director position at the F1 team, in order to become Chief Technical Officer. The new role will see Allison take on a more strategic role, with the aim of helping the team through the expansive regulation changes being introduced next year, rather than being directly responsible for overseeing the new car design.
